Could I use SS fuel lines for brake lines?
32774, RE: Brake lines
Posted by CODE4, Dec-31-69 06:00 PM
you are too vague. Are you referring to braided stainless AN lines? In that case yes if the line rated for high pressure. Braided AN line is not "fuel line" - most people only see it used there.

Get the appropriate adapters and some -3 AN line and do it. Usually more expensive than buying off the shelf braided lines though.
32776, RE: Brake lines
Posted by RoninEclipse2G, Dec-31-69 06:00 PM
I wouldn't do it. Braided brake hose isn't rated for the same chemicals as fuel line. It might hold the pressure but it probably won't last very long before it starts to rot from the inside.

If you're talking stainless hard line, go for it. Basically the same stuff.
